[发明专利]数据处理方法、装置及存储介质在审
| 申请号: | 202010100015.0 | 申请日: | 2020-02-18 |
| 公开(公告)号: | CN111324620A | 公开(公告)日: | 2020-06-23 |
| 发明(设计)人: | 刘乾;裴宏祥;王鹏;刘贺;孙鑫;曹朦胧 | 申请(专利权)人: | 中国联合网络通信集团有限公司 |
| 主分类号: | G06F16/23 | 分类号: | G06F16/23;G06F16/2455;G06F16/27 |
| 代理公司: | 北京同立钧成知识产权代理有限公司 11205 | 代理人: | 杨俊辉;刘芳 |
| 地址: | 100033 *** | 国省代码: | 北京;11 |
| 权利要求书: | 查看更多 | 说明书: | 查看更多 |
| 摘要: | |||
| 搜索关键词: | 数据处理 方法 装置 存储 介质 | ||
1.一种数据处理方法,其特征在于,包括:
接收客户端发送的数据请求;
根据所述数据请求,分别从物理库和缓存库中获取所述数据请求对应的数据;
通过数据比对算法获取所述物理库和所述缓存库中的差异数据块;
根据所述差异数据块的差异类型,对所述缓存库中的差异数据块进行数据修复,所述数据修复用于保持所述物理库和所述缓存库的数据一致。
2.根据权利要求1所述的方法,其特征在于,所述通过数据比对算法获取所述物理库和所述缓存库中的差异数据块,包括:
通过内存比较memcmp算法获取所述物理库和所述缓存库中的差异数据块。
3.根据权利要求1所述的方法,其特征在于,所述数据请求包括数据写入请求、数据更新请求、数据删除请求、数据查询请求的任意一种,所述通过数据比对算法获取所述物理库和所述缓存库中的差异数据块之前,还包括:
确定从所述物理库和所述缓存库中获取的数据是否有数据比对记录;
若所述数据无数据比对记录,则执行通过数据比对算法获取所述物理库和所述缓存库中的差异数据块的步骤。
4.根据权利要求3所述的方法,其特征在于,所述确定从所述物理库和所述缓存库中获取的数据是否有数据比对记录,包括:
采用布隆过滤器确定从所述物理库和所述缓存库中获取的数据是否有数据比对记录,所述布隆过滤器用于记录在预设时段内执行过数据比对的数据。
5.根据权利要求3或4所述的方法,其特征在于,所述通过数据比对算法获取所述物理库和所述缓存库中的差异数据块,包括:
对从所述物理库和所述缓存库中获取的数据进行序列化处理,分别得到第一序列化数据和第二序列化数据;
通过数据比对算法从所述第一序列化数据和所述第二序列化数据中获取物理库和缓存库中的差异数据块。
6.根据权利要求1所述的方法,其特征在于,所述数据请求包括全量数据核查请求,所述通过数据比对算法获取所述物理库和所述缓存库中的差异数据块,包括:
按照字段对应关系,将从所述物理库中获取的数据转换成第一内存块数据,将从所述缓存库中获取的数据转换成第二内存块数据;
通过数据比对算法从所述第一内存块数据和所述第二内存块数据中获取所述物理库和所述缓存库中的差异数据块。
7.根据权利要求6所述的方法,其特征在于,所述通过数据比对算法从所述第一内存块数据和所述第二内存块数据中获取所述物理库和所述缓存库中的差异数据块,包括:
若所述第一内存块数据和所述第二内存块数据存在不一致的情况,采用二分法将所述第一内存块数据和所述第二内存块数据对半拆分;
通过数据比对算法,从拆分后的所述第一内存块数据和所述第二内存块数据中获取所述物理库和所述缓存库中的差异数据块。
8.根据权利要求1所述的方法,其特征在于,所述根据所述差异数据块的差异类型,对所述缓存库中的差异数据块进行数据修复,包括:
若所述差异类型为全字段差异,则删除所述缓存库中的差异数据块,将与所述缓存库中的差异数据块对应的所述物理库中的数据块覆盖至所述差异数据块的位置;
若所述差异类型为部分字段差异,则删除所述缓存库中的差异数据块中的部分字段数据,将与所述缓存库中的差异数据块对应的物理库中的数据块覆盖至所述差异数据块的部分字段位置。
9.一种数据处理装置,其特征在于,包括:
接收模块,用于接收客户端发送的数据请求;
获取模块,用于根据所述数据请求,分别从物理库和缓存库中获取所述数据请求对应的数据;
数据比对模块,用于通过数据比对算法获取所述物理库和所述缓存库中的差异数据块;
数据处理模块,用于根据所述差异数据块的差异类型,对所述缓存库中的差异数据块进行数据修复,所述数据修复用于保持所述物理库和所述缓存库的数据一致。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于中国联合网络通信集团有限公司,未经中国联合网络通信集团有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202010100015.0/1.html,转载请声明来源钻瓜专利网。
- 上一篇:用于向量单元的密码引擎和调度方法
- 下一篇:一种对话者的提示方法及穿戴设备





